Gustatory Rhinitis with Subsequent Thirst

You are experiencing gustatory rhinitis, a vagally-mediated syndrome where drinking any liquid triggers watery nasal discharge for 30-40 minutes, and the subsequent thirst you feel is likely your body's response to fluid loss through excessive nasal secretions. 1, 2

Understanding Your Condition

What's Happening Physiologically

  • Gustatory rhinitis occurs when drinking (or eating) stimulates muscarinic receptors on submucosal glands in your nose, causing profuse watery discharge 2
  • The mechanism is vagally-mediated and involves enhanced cholinergic glandular secretory activity, not an allergic or inflammatory process 1
  • Your thirst after the rhinorrhea episode likely represents fluid loss through the nasal secretions, creating a frustrating cycle where drinking to satisfy thirst triggers more nasal discharge 2

Key Distinguishing Features

  • This is not an allergic reaction—there's no IgE involvement, no itching, no sneezing fits, and no other systemic symptoms 1
  • Unlike typical gustatory rhinitis triggered by hot/spicy foods, your symptoms occur with any liquid, suggesting heightened sensitivity of your nasal cholinergic pathways 1, 2
  • The 30-40 minute duration is consistent with the time course of vagally-mediated secretory responses 2

Breaking the Cycle: Treatment Algorithm

First-Line Treatment: Topical Anticholinergic

Apply topical atropine nasal spray 10-15 minutes before drinking to prophylactically block the muscarinic receptors that trigger your rhinorrhea 2

  • Atropine has been shown to clinically block food-induced rhinorrhea and significantly inhibit nasal secretions in gustatory rhinitis 2
  • This addresses the root cause by preventing the vagal stimulation of nasal glands 2
  • You would apply this before each drinking episode initially, then potentially reduce frequency as symptoms improve 2

Alternative Approach: Temperature Modification

Try sipping ice-cold carbonated water instead of room-temperature or warm beverages 3

  • Cold temperature may reduce vagal nerve sensitivity and decrease cholinergic glandular activity 3
  • Carbonation provides additional sensory input that may help "reset" the hypersensitive pharyngeal-nasal reflex 3
  • This approach showed 63% improvement in patients with persistent pharyngeal mucus awareness and throat clearing, a related vagally-mediated condition 3

Managing the Thirst Component

Small, frequent sips rather than large volumes at once may reduce the intensity of vagal stimulation 2

  • Smaller volumes may trigger less pronounced nasal secretory responses 2
  • This allows you to maintain hydration without overwhelming the system 2
  • Space your fluid intake to allow complete resolution of rhinorrhea between drinking episodes (wait the full 30-40 minutes) 2

When to Seek Further Evaluation

Red Flags Requiring Medical Assessment

  • If you develop unilateral (one-sided) clear nasal discharge, which could indicate cerebrospinal fluid leak rather than gustatory rhinitis 4
  • If nasal discharge becomes purulent, bloody, or foul-smelling, suggesting infectious or neoplastic causes 4
  • If you develop facial pain, vision changes, or severe headaches 4

Consider Underlying Conditions

While your symptoms sound like pure gustatory rhinitis, alcohol consumption can trigger similar nasal symptoms through different mechanisms 1, 5

  • If you're drinking alcoholic beverages specifically, nasal vasodilation from alcohol itself may compound the problem 1
  • Alcohol-induced nasal symptoms are more common in people with underlying asthma, COPD, or allergic rhinitis 5
  • Red wine and white wine are the most frequent triggers, with white wine containing higher sulfite levels 6, 5

Common Pitfalls to Avoid

  • Don't use topical decongestant sprays (like oxymetazoline/Afrin) for this condition—they work through vasoconstriction, not anticholinergic mechanisms, and will cause rebound congestion without addressing your underlying problem 7
  • Don't assume this is allergic rhinitis and waste time on antihistamines or intranasal corticosteroids, which won't help vagally-mediated gustatory rhinitis 1, 2
  • Don't restrict fluid intake to avoid symptoms, as this will lead to dehydration and worsen your thirst 1
